PUBLIC HEARINGS - continued 5:00 P.M. – Request for Special Exception and the Draft Environmental Impact Statement (DEIS) prepared for The Enclaves Hotel and Restaurant #7046 - The project is 6.75 acres and is located on the north side of Main Road +/-90 feet west of the intersection of Main Road and Town Harbor Lane. The property address is 56655 Main Road, Southold. Plans include the conversion of an existing two-story home into a 74-seat restaurant and construction of a 44- unit hotel, including four detached cottages upon a parcel located at 56655 Main Road, Southold, NY, particularly known as Suffolk County Tax Map No. 1000-63-3-15.
